In Florence Cooking Class & Market Food Tour, prepare an authentic Tuscan meal under the guidance of a professional chef in the city’s heart.
At Central Market, select fresh ingredients with your chef to craft an Italian dish showcasing local flavors.
Before cooking begins, sample traditional delicacies and then engage in preparing a delicious meal by chopping, blending, takeing, and whipping up various components.
Relish the culinary creations you've made while enjoying unlimited Chianti wine during lunch as part of the Florence Cooking Class & Market Food Tour.
Receive a completion certificate and take home a recipe booklet filled with favorite recipes from your chef to recreate at home.

Be aware that Central Market is closed on Sundays and public holidays. On these days, the class will feature a special introduction to Tuscan cooking along with additional local product tastings. If there are any food intolerances or allergies, please notify us beforehand. The experience supports vegetarian preferences; kindly specify your meal choice in advance. However, it's not suitable for individuals with celiac disease.
